Four Horsemen Brewery Brewing better beer from the beginning of the end of time! www.FourHorsemen.beer We source our ingredients from Washington State and its' local farmers.

The team at Four Horsemen Brewery is dedicated to creating a green company in every aspect of making beer. We started our business with a small carbon footprint so we don't have to try to reduce our carbon footprint in years to come. We will continue to source locally as we find people really do support us for that. Thanks for the support and Cheers to Good Beers!

Many of you know me as one of the family owners of Four Horsemen Brewery. Over the years, you've shared a beer with us, attended events, supported our small business, and watched us navigate some incredibly difficult challenges.

Like many business owners and property owners, we’ve spent years dealing with overly burdensome government regulations, property taxes, appeals, public records requests, and fighting through systems that are confusing, unresponsive, and difficult for ordinary people to navigate. Those experiences have taught me a lot about how government impacts everyday residents, families, and small businesses.

After spending years challenging King County, advocating for property rights, participating in property tax appeals and researching our entire property tax system, I’ve been actively pushing to improve transparency and accountability in our local government, and therefore decided to run for King County Assessor.

This isn't a decision I made lightly. I'm not a career politician. I'm a small family business owner, taxpayer, and King County resident who believes property owners deserve a system that is transparent, accountable, understandable, and fair.

I appreciate all of the support our community has shown our family and our business over the years. I look forward to still being a family business owner while also pushing to bring fairness and accountability to a system that is broken and needs fixed.

— Dominique Scarimbolo
Candidate for King County Assessor
